High-strength recycled aggregate concrete and preparation method thereof
The invention relates to the field of concrete, and particularly discloses high-strength recycled aggregate concrete and a preparation method thereof. The concrete is prepared from 300 to 350 parts ofcement, 80 to 100 parts of fly ash, 10 to 20 parts of silicon powder, 800 to 900 parts of a fine aggregate, 1400 to 1500 parts of a modified recycled coarse aggregate, 200 to 300 parts of water and 9to 15 parts of a water reducing agent, the preparation method of the modified recycled coarse aggregate comprises the following steps: S1, adding 400-500 parts of a recycled coarse aggregate, 60-70 parts of slag, 80-90 parts of an alkaline activator and 5-10 parts of calcium lignosulphonate into 140-150 parts of water, wherein the alkaline activator comprises sodium hydroxide powder and water glass powder in a weight ratio of (2-3): 1, and S2, adding 5-10 parts of wollastonite, 5-10 parts of quartz powder, 10-20 parts of organic silicon resin and 5-10 parts of a silane coupling agent into theproduct obtained in the step S1, mixing, and curing. The preparation method of the concrete comprises: mixing the concrete raw material modified recycled coarse aggregate, fine aggregate, silicon powder and half of water in parts by weight to obtain an aggregate mixture, adding the rest raw materials, and mixing to obtain recycled aggregate concrete. The recycled aggregate concrete has the advantage of high strength.
